A volt meter wont tell you much about your battery condition. If you get a low voltage with just a volt meter your battery is shot for sure. Battery voltage needs to be checked under load. You likely just ran it down and you will be fine. But, you are at 3ish years, and depending on different factors yours could be on its way out.
I recommend the next time it needs a jump, you call road side service and hang out for a half an hour at the most. The MB dude will be there with a new battery for FREE!!!

Not covered under extended warranties for sure.
Also, battery needs to test as bad when a road side tech shows up. He will load test it. However, based on what I witnessed when he did mine, it was quick and hardly fully diagnostic. I sense if your car simply wont start and they come out, you will get a new battery. The dealership they work for makes money from the factory! Simple as that.

I have a 2010 E 350, 78K. Every time I'm overseas, my wife has the battery die. I brought it to MB to check the charging system etc. and everything is fine. It just happened again with me home, (12th time?), so I put the battery on a trickle charge to make sure it was full. I pulled the cover over the battery after 2 hours because it was still drawing 2 amps, and found the AC fan still running! Something is not triggering the AC fan to shut off. I restarted the car, turned the AC off, and the fan stayed off when I shut it down. I then restarted and left the AC on; it turned off as it should. Anyone know what would randomly keep the AC blower motor indefinitely running with the car off, locked, and key not present?
